What would you like to know. You can go 2 routes with a 6.0. There is the LQ4 from 2500/3500, Yukon Denali, Suburban LTZ. 325 HP out of the box. Its a lot easier to find used. Then there is the LQ9 which I have. 345 HP out of the box. Its an LQ4 with flat top pistons. Higher compression and it uses 91-93 octane gas. It was in the Silverado SS, Sierra Denali, Escalade.
